Horizon Extreme Events in a Changing Climate
Funds three €6M research projects that improve prediction and preparedness for extreme weather and climate events across Europe and beyond.
Climate change is making many extreme events more frequent or severe, while hazards can interact in ways that amplify their effects. This topic funds research that improves understanding of past and present extremes, explains their causes and likelihood, and strengthens prediction and projection across timescales from short-range weather to sub-seasonal and multi-decadal change.

Research on the causes, interactions, likelihood and impacts of extreme events in a changing climate, including isolated, compound and cascading hazards. Projects combine models, observations, digital twins and innovative analysis to improve attribution, seamless prediction and projection, early warning, risk assessment and adaptation, support EUCRA and the EU Mission on Adaptation, and coordinate with Copernicus, Destination Earth and ESA FutureEO activities.
